فهرست مطالب
Toggleکمپانی آلمانی زیمنس بزرگترین برند تولیدکننده تجهیزات اتوماسیون صنعتی در جهان است. PLC، درایو و HMI از مهمترین محصولات اتوماسیون زیمنس هستند. برای استفاده از این تجهیزات، از جمله PLC زیمنس نیازمند برنامهنویسی و پیکربندی نرمافزاری هستیم؛ بنابراین پلتفرمهای نرمافزاری نقش مهمی در طراحی، پیادهسازی، نظارت و بهکارگیری سیستم اتوماسیون ایفا میکنند. در این مقاله نرمافزارهای اتوماسیون زیمنس را معرفی میکنیم و کاربرد هر یک را بهاختصار شرح میدهیم. در صورتی که به یادگیری مهارت اتوماسیون صنعتی زیمنس علاقهمند هستید، میتوانید با ثبتنام در دوره اتوماسیون زیمنس ماهر از صفر تا صد طراحی، برنامهنویسی، پیادهسازی، عیبیابی و راهاندازی سیستم اتوماسیون زیمنس را فرا بگیرید.
نرمافزارهای اتوماسیون زیمنس
در صنعت اتوماسیون هر برندی نرمافزارهای مخصوصی را برای برنامهنویسی و پیکربندی تجهیزات خود ارائه میدهد. شرکت زیمنس نرمافزارهای زیر را برای برنامه نویسی تجهیزات خود در اختیار کاربران قرار داده است.
- TIA Portal
- SIMATIC Step7
- WinCC
- LOGO! Soft Comfort
در ادامه کاربرد هر یک از این نرمافزارها را معرفی میکنیم.
نرمافزار TIA Portal
نرمافزار TIA Portal یک پلتفرم جامع نرمافزاری است که با استفاده از آن میتوان بیشتر تجهیزات اتوماسیون صنعتی شرکت زیمنس را برنامهنویسی و پیکربندی کرد. همچنین این نرمافزار امکان شبیهسازی و عیبیابی کامل یک سیستم اتوماسیون زیمنس را به کاربر میدهد. تنها برخی PLCهای قدیمی زیمنس هستند که امکان برنامهنویسی آنها در TIA Portal وجود ندارد. با ورود تجهیزات جدید به بازار، نسخههای جدیدتر TIA Portal با قابلیت پشتیبانی آن تجهیزات و امکانات جدید ارائه شدهاند.
نرمافزار TIA Portal شامل پکیجهای نرمافزاری مختلف برای کار با PLC و HMI و همچنین درایوهای الکتریکی است. برای هر یک از این پکیجهای نرمافزاری، خدمات پشتیبانی مختلفی وجود دارد. همه نسخههای TIA Portal با نسخه Windows 10 64-bit سازگار هستند. در ادامه پکیجهای نرمافزاری پرکاربرد تیا پورتال را معرفی کرده و نحوه انتخاب نسخه مناسب برای کاربردهای مختلف را بیان میکنیم (جدول ۱).
جدول ۱- پکیج STEP 7 – SIMATIC S7 PLC
سختافزار PLC |
نسخه نرمافزار مورد نیاز |
---|---|
S7-1200 |
Step 7 Basic |
S7-1500 و نرمافزار کنترلی آن |
tep 7 Professional |
S7-300 (با نسخه firmware بالاتر از V2.6) |
Step 7 Professional |
S7-400 - بهجز سیپییوهای S7-400H |
Step 7 Professional |
Step 7 Professional |
Step 7 Professional |
هر دو نرمافزار S7-PLCSIM (نرمافزار برنامهنویسی PLC) و WinCC Basic (نرمافزار طراحی برنامه HMI) در نسخههای Step 7- Basic و Step 7- Professional وجود دارند.
در صورت نیاز به استفاده از هر مدل سختافزار دیگر در کنار S7-1200، به نسخه Step 7- Professional برای برنامهنویسی نیاز خواهید داشت.
برای مدلهای S7-300 که نسخه firmware سیپییو آنها قدیمیتر از V2.6 است یا سیپییوهای S7-7400H، نرمافزار Step7 5.6 یا Step7 Professional 2017 مورد نیاز خواهد بود.
در فایلهای Programming Style Guide و Programming Guideline for S7-1200/1500 نکات، ترفندها و رویههای صحیح پیشبرد پروژه PLCهای S7-1200 و S7-1500 در TIA Portal ارائه شده است.
سختافزار PLC |
نسخه نرمافزار مورد نیاز |
---|---|
S7-1200FC |
STEP 7 Safety Basic** |
S7-1500F و نرمافزار کنترلی آن - سیپییو ET200SF |
STEP 7 Safety Advanced |
S7-300F (با نسخه firmware بالاتر از V2.6) |
STEP 7 Safety Advanced |
S7-400 |
STEP 7 Safety Advanced |
ET200SP F-CPU |
STEP 7 Safety Advanced |
جدول ۲- پکیج STEP 7 – Safety – پکیج اضافهشده (Add-on) برای برنامهنویسی Fail-safe
* پیش از نصب Step-7 Safety باید نسخه متناظر نرمافزار Step 7 به عنوان پیشنیاز روی سیستم نصب شده باشد.
در صورتی که لازم است هر مدل سیپییو Fail-safe دیگری در کنار S7-1200FC برنامهنویسی شود، به Step 7 Safety Advanced نیاز خواهید داشت.
سختافزار HMI |
نسخه نرمافزار مورد نیاز |
---|---|
پنلهای HMI Basic |
WinCC Basic |
پنلهای HMI Comfort |
WinCC Comfort |
ایستگاه تکی PC مانند SIMATIC IPC |
WinCC Advanced for engineering, WinCC Runtime Advanced for runtime ** |
ایستگاههای چندتایی PC یا SCADA |
WinCC Professional for engineering*, WinCC Runtime Professional for runtime** |
پنلهای HMI Unified Comfort |
WinCC Unified* |
جدول ۳- پکیج WinCC – نرمافزار طراحی برنامه برای SIMATIC HMI
* دو نرمافزار WinCC Unified و WinCC Professional را نمیتوان بهصورت همزمان نصب کرد.
دو نسخه WinCC Runtime Professional و WinCC Runtime Advanced نرمافزارهای Tag-based هستند که روی خود PLC بارگذاری میشوند.
مدل درایو |
کاری که قرار است انجام شود |
نرمافزار درایو مورد نیاز |
---|---|---|
G120, S120, S210 |
راهاندازی و عیبیابی |
Startdrive Basic V16 |
G120, S120, S210 |
تستهای ایمنی یکپارچه |
Startdrive Advanced V16 |
G130, G150, S150 |
راهاندازی و عیبیابی |
Startdrive Basic V16 |
جدول ۴- پکیج StartDrive – نرمافزار راهاندازی درایو
برای اطلاعات بیشتر در مورد ترفندهای استفاده از StartDrive در نرمافزار TIA Portal راهنمای Getting Started – SINAMICS Startdrive را مطالعه کنید.
نرمافزارهای دیگر
چنانکه گفته شد، نرمافزار TIA Portal پلتفرم جامع زیمنس برای سیستمهای اتوماسیون است؛ اما برای برنامهنویسی محصولات قدیمیتر زیمنس (مثلا مدلهای قدیمی S7-300) و همچنین برای PLCهای LOGO باید از نرمافزارهای دیگری استفاده شود. در جدول ۵ این نرمافزارها را معرفی میکنیم.
سختافزار PLC |
نرمافزار مورد نیاز |
---|---|
S7-300 (قبل از ۲۰۰۹), S7-400, S7-400H |
STEP 7 V5.6 or STEP 7 Professional 2017 |
S7-200 |
S7-Microwin |
LOGO! |
LOGO! Soft Comfort |
Legacy SIMATIC HMI panels (Micro, TP, OP, MP) |
WinCC flexible 2008 SP5 |
جدول ۵- نرمافزارهای دیگر زیمنس و کاربرد آنها
در صورتی که با انواع مدلهای PLC زیمنس آشنایی ندارید میتوانید مقاله زیر را در وبسایت ماهر بخوانید.
جمعبندی
شبیهسازی، پیکربندی، برنامهنویسی و عیبیابی از مراحل مهم اجرای هر سیستم اتوماسیون هستند. انجام چنین مراحلی نیازمند استفاده از پلتفرمهای نرمافزاری ویژه برای هر برند از تجهیزات اتوماسیون است. در این مقاله نرمافزارهای اصلی طراحی سیستمهای اتوماسیون زیمنس معرفی و نحوه انتخاب نسخه مناسب نرمافزارها برای انواع سختافزار زیمنس بیان شد. اطلاعات دقیق در مورد نحوه کار با نرمافزارهای معرفی شده را میتوانید با مطالعه هندبوکهای منتشرشده توسط زیمنس که لینک آنها در متن این مقاله قرار داده شدهاند، به دست آورید.
منابع
https://www.awc-inc.com/siemens-programming-software-selection-guide